#d15373 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d15373 is composed of 82% red, 32.5%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.3% magenta, 45%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 344.8 degrees, a saturation of 57.8% and a lightness of 57.3%. #d15373 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a6e6 with #a30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#d15373 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d15373 has RGB values of R:209, G:83, B:115 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.45,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13718387.
